Handover, Dovrel to on-call: the Stilchfield SQL linter now enforces uppercase keywords and bans SELECT * in migration files. Expect noisy failures on legacy Harbrook migrations until the grandfather list merges Monday. If the lint runner's cache store wedges overnight, unlock it and clear state. The cache vault opens with the recovery passphrase directly below.

unlock words, yawig-kagef: gordor-holvan-ulaael-pramir-ulaiel-tamdor

SEC-771: Proctorly exam queue misconfigured in the Varnholt region. Staging workers are draining the production proctoring queue because the env file was cloned wholesale. Exams paused as mitigation. Needs review: blast radius, whether any session media crossed environments, and credential rotation. Remediation requires a fresh staging env file containing the following line.

vault entry, kafog-yahop: COURIER_KEY8=0faa53ae

Subject: Key rotation for InvoiceForge renderer

Welcome, new folks. Every quarter we rotate the credential the Pellworth PDF invoice renderer uses to call our internal asset service, Vaultline. The old key stops working Friday at noon. Update your local .env and the staging config before then, and verify a test invoice renders with the new embedded fonts. For convenience, the freshly issued key is included here.

app token of bagef-bageg = kto11_vuwA0uhrEMg

**Q: I'm locked out of Rotavault after my first rotation run. What now?**

This is common for new contractors. Rotavault, our internal secrets-rotation utility at Mirenfeld Systems, invalidates your bootstrap token after the first successful cycle. You'll need to re-enroll from the staging console. Enter the recovery passphrase below when prompted.

strongbox words: oliath-framir